Companies from Ceará are expected to lose more than R$ 600 million with steel tariffs imposed by Trump; see impacts - Negócios - Diário do Nordeste

Summary by Portal Verdes Mares
Steel represented 37% of Ceará's exports in 2024, totaling US$ 545 million sold abroad. Of these, just over 80%, representing US$ 438.2 million, went to the United States. Thus, the decision of the North American president
